Heard: bill to make June 'Male Wellness Month' emphasizes preventive care and mental health
Senate Health Committee · November 5, 2025

Representative Lorenz presented House Bill 207 to designate June as Male Wellness Month and promote preventive care, mental-health awareness and reduced stigma; sponsors described it as bipartisan and symbolic, and the committee closed the first hearing with no questions.
The Senate Health Committee took first hearing testimony on House Bill 207, a measure to designate June as "Male Wellness Month" and establish a related awareness day to encourage preventive care.
